summ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orChase Douglas <chase.douglas@ubuntu.com>2011-12-13 17:02:48 -0800
committerChase Douglas <chase.douglas@ubuntu.com>2011-12-13 17:02:48 -0800
commit9b93e8df1f350fd1fc3cd0888c0bf565bf3e18f0 (patch)
treeacddc2408ba05a59eb15408077250848bd345b19
parent41d0b41fc5b244438af787de687a4b341889cadc (diff)
Move check result test to configure.ac and use standard variables
-rw-r--r--configure.ac3
-rw-r--r--m4/gtest.m44
2 files changed, 4 insertions, 3 deletions
diff --git a/configure.ac b/configure.ac
index b30cab0..b2cef93 100644
--- a/configure.ac
+++ b/configure.ac
@@ -31,6 +31,9 @@ PKG_CHECK_MODULES( XSERVER, x11 [xorg-server] )
# Check for Google Test
AC_CHECK_GTEST
+AS_IF([test "x$ac_cv_lib_gtest_main" != xyes],
+ AC_MSG_ERROR([package 'gtest' not found]))
+
AC_SUBST([GTEST_LDFLAGS])
AC_SUBST([GTEST_CXXFLAGS])
diff --git a/m4/gtest.m4 b/m4/gtest.m4
index 69b8867..760638a 100644
--- a/m4/gtest.m4
+++ b/m4/gtest.m4
@@ -18,8 +18,6 @@ AC_DEFUN([AC_CHECK_GTEST],
AC_LANG_CPLUSPLUS
- AC_CHECK_LIB([gtest], [main], [have_gtest=yes],
- AC_MSG_ERROR([package 'gtest' not found]))
-
+ AC_CHECK_LIB([gtest], [main])
]) # AC_CHECK_GTEST